Summers Day

Mid summers Day

green grasses blow in the breeze
as a warm breath touches my face

sun kisses the morning blooms
as they turn towards its light

birds sing a happy tune

rabbits hop along the way

sounds of insects fill the air

the clear stream trickles by
over stone it ripples 
a mirror of the sky
